WWE Star Calls Rumor About Him “The Weakest” Story He’s Heard

Amid a recent surge in popularity, Karrion Kross has found himself at the center of online rumors, which he is now laughing off. A recent rumor suggested that Kross refuses to take “flat back bumps,” offering a potential reason for a perceived lack of a major push.

In an interview with The National to promote WWE Night of Champions, Kross addressed the speculation head-on, dismissing it as the “weakest” story he’s heard about himself recently.

“I thought out of all the crazy articles that are fabricated about me every week, that was the weakest,” Kross said while laughing. “There was another wild one I saw last week that was even funnier.”

He then shared another rumor he found amusing. “It said something like, ‘Karrion Kross is going to come to Monday Night Raw and he’s going to quit and do a shoot promo live, and then walk out.’ I thought that was a good one. But I don’t really respond to any of them. There’s a crazy one about me every week or two. You just kind of have to laugh.”

Recent backstage reports have corroborated Kross’s statement, with WWE producers confirming that his willingness to take bumps has never been an issue. Kross is scheduled to face Sami Zayn at Night of Champions this Saturday, his first premium live event match since WrestleMania 40.
